Nvidia Boosts AI in Healthcare Portfolio
Nvidia, a client of my firm, Cambrian-AI Research, has disclosed significant contributions in medicine at the conference that foretell coming advances in healthcare enabled by AI. As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ang has forecasted, we are entering the age of physical AI, and healthcare is no exception. Nvidia powers the first digital devices for healthcare from Synchron, Moon Surgical, Neptune Medical, and Virtual Incision.
It Takes Three Computers to Build Healthcare Physical AI
Nvidia chips power medical devices now in market. It takes three computers to create physical AI, with DGX creating the model, simulating the physical world with Omniverse, and then running the actual smart device with Holoscan on IGX. Needless to say, Nvidia is providing a comprehensive platform for healthcare solution providers.
Partnerships and Collaborations
At the Healthcare Conference, Nvidia announced results from several partnerships, including Mayo Clinic. The Mayo Clinic and NVIDIA are accelerating AI-driven digital pathology by developing multi-modal foundation models and working toward a human digital twin for improved disease understanding and treatment strategies. Nvidia has also partnered with IQVIA to integrate Nvidia AI Foundry and AI Enterprise to accelerate agentic AI solutions for 10,000 healthcare and life science customers.
